Output d3baf38f9431cdb3277a0791f1dcebc32e0e2a75fe6ca539ad0bdac61887eb6d:13

value
689000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4450dd96a67593443a656e88937141faac025e70 OP_EQUAL
address
37vEkE8dHLJvsNhJCoZnFcYC7abYfwjueU
transaction
d3baf38f9431cdb3277a0791f1dcebc32e0e2a75fe6ca539ad0bdac61887eb6d
spent
true